Pipe bender - useful in household a device that allows you to bend metal or polymer pipe at a certain degree. Bent pipes are often used in the construction of greenhouses and greenhouses, installation of heating and other needs. Using the presented drawing, manual pipe bender you can make it yourself.

A vice is a practical device used when performing plumbing work. With its help, it is possible to reliably fix a part requiring metalworking in a certain position.

This device consists of several parts:

  • base plate;
  • 2nd lips – movable and non-movable;
  • lever;
  • chassis screw.

Using a small-sized bench vice, the drawing of which is presented above, it is convenient to sharpen and otherwise process small parts.

The simplest milling machine can be made on the basis of a drill. To do this, it is fixed to a steel profile or to a plywood body, and a rotating clamp is placed opposite it. Parts are processed using special cutters held by hand.

Homemade lathe

Creating a lathe with your own hands allows you to make dishes, interior decor and furniture from wooden blanks. Such a device will become an affordable alternative to industrial production and will help realize your creative potential. A homemade lathe can be made from individual components and parts:

  • an electric motor used as an electric drive for the machine;
  • a headstock, which can serve as an electric sharpener;
  • tailstock made from a drill;
  • stop for cutters;
  • transverse guides;
  • a frame made of metal profiles or beams.

The headstock and tailstock of a lathe are the main working elements, between which a wooden workpiece is placed. The rotating movement from the electric motor is transmitted to the workpiece through the front headstock, while the rear headstock remains static, responsible for holding the workpiece. Technology for making a shelf for tools with your own hands (shield):

  1. From plywood sheet The shield is cut out, and the places where the shelves will be installed are marked on it.
  2. Using a jigsaw, shelves with side walls are cut out. The length of these sides must match the length of the shield.
  3. Shelves for tools are assembled and fixed to the surface of the shield using long self-tapping screws.
  4. Hooks are being installed. Holes are made in the shield where dowels are installed. You need to screw special hooks equipped with threads into them. First, you should distribute the entire tool and mark the points where it will hang.
  5. Brackets or lugs are installed on the rear wall of the structure.

All that remains is to fix the shield shelf on the wall. To prevent the lugs from sliding off the anchors, it is recommended to fix them with special washers.

Technology and drawings of a do-it-yourself carpentry workbench: how to make a simple design

Step-by-step technology for manufacturing the structure:

  1. To make a lid for a wooden carpentry workbench, you will need to take thick boards. The size must be selected so that, as a result of their connection, a shield with parameters of 0.7x2 m is obtained (the length can be less than 2 m). Long nails should be used as fasteners, which must be driven in from the front side and bent from the back.
  2. You can finish the lid by securing a beam with a section of 50x50 mm along its lower perimeter.
  3. Depending on the size of the carpentry workbench (its cover), vertical supports are located. To make them, a timber (12x12x130 cm) is taken. At this stage it is necessary to take into account the height work surface, because it should be comfortable. The upper limit of the support should be at the level of your lowered arms. Subsequently, due to the installation of the cover, about 8-10 cm will be added to this indicator. Markings for installing the beams should be applied to the ground and these elements should be dug to a depth of 0.2-0.35 m.
  4. Next, we install the frame part and the cover of the wooden workbench with our own hands. The installed support bars must be connected in pairs. For this, wide boards are used, fixed at a height of 0.2-0.4 m with long screws. The cover is secured to the ends of the supports using the same fasteners.

Note! Do not use nails to install the cover. During the process of driving them in, the frame part of the product may move.

Technology for making a folding workbench with your own hands:

  1. Vertical supports are installed in a similar way and are connected to each other using horizontally located jumpers. Before installing the jumpers, grooves should be made on them for nuts and washers. To do this, it is better to use a hammer and chisel.
  2. When the jumpers are set to required level, through holes are made in a horizontal bar and a vertically installed support. The long bolt will be inserted here. On the side where there is a groove for fastening, put on a nut and washer, after which the element is tightened well.
  3. You will need 2 horizontal jumpers for the frame part of a homemade carpentry workbench. on each of 4 sides. You will also need a couple of jumpers for installation under the work surface (in the center). The elements under the table top are designed for drawers. The distance between these jumpers must correspond to the size of the boxes.
  4. Bolts are also used to fix the working surface. Mounting recesses are prepared at the ends of the supports, and holes for fastening are prepared on the tabletop. The bolts are installed so that their heads are recessed (1-2 mm).

DIY carpenter's vice design for a workbench

Usually workbenches are equipped with a vice. Many garage workshop owners know how to make such a device with their own hands. For homemade design you will need special pins. Such fasteners are sold in hardware stores.

To work, you will need a special screw pin. This threaded part is the main operating component of the structure. Minimum diameter pin – 2 cm, cutting length – 15 cm. The longer this part is, the wider the vice can be spread. If you take into account exactly these dimensional parameters in the drawings of a vice with your own hands, you can get a design that is set apart by almost 8 cm.

The jaws of the tool are made from a pair of boards. One part of the part will be fixed. To make it you need to take pine. The second part measuring 2x1.8x50 cm will move. In each of these boards you need to make a hole for a screw. Using a drill with a diameter of 1 cm, holes for the studs are formed in all boards at the same time. To prevent the holes from moving relative to each other, you can connect them using nails.

After all the holes are made, the screw and all the studs are inserted into them along with the washer and nut.

Helpful advice! To be able to process workpieces different sizes, you need to make the studs repositionable. You will need to make a couple of additional holes in each of the boards, located near the screw clamp.

Do-it-yourself workbench manufacturing technology: how to assemble

Manufacturing universal workbench Do it yourself starts with assembling the frame. To do this, you need to take a couple of short and a couple of long beams. During the welding process, these elements may become twisted.

To prevent this, you must:

  1. Lay out the parts on a perfectly flat plane.
  2. In the places where the connecting points are located (there are 4 of them), the beams are tacked using the spot welding method.
  3. After this, all welding seams are fully completed. First on one side of the frame, then on its reverse side.

Then the rear vertical racks and the rear beam (long, one of three) are attached. You definitely need to check how evenly they are placed in relation to each other. If there are any deviations, the beams can be carefully bent using a hammer. At the end, the remaining vertical rack elements are assembled, as well as elements that provide rigidity.

When the frame is ready, corners can be welded to it to strengthen the structure. The tabletop is formed from wooden planks. They must first be soaked in a fire-resistant liquid. Then a sheet of metal is laid on top.

A plywood tool shield can be mounted on the vertical rack elements. The same material is used to sew up the cabinets. For boxes, you can use metal boxes or make wooden structures.

DIY knife sharpening devices: drawings and recommendations

To make a sharpener from a washing machine motor with your own hands, you can limit yourself to a motor from an old Soviet design, for example, SMR-1.5 or Riga-17. A power of 200 W will be enough, although you can increase this figure to 400 W by choosing a different engine option.

The list of parts needed for a DIY sharpening machine includes:

  • tube (to grind the flange);
  • a nut for fixing the stone on the pulley;
  • metal for making a protective casing for a sharpener with your own hands (thickness 2.-2.5 mm);
  • whetstone;
  • an electrical cable cord having a plug;
  • starting device;
  • a corner made of metal or a block of wood (for the frame).

The diameter of the flange must match the dimensions of the bushing on the motor. In addition, this part will be fitted with grindstone. On one side, this element is threaded. The indentation should be equal to the thickness of the circle multiplied by 2. The thread is applied with a tap. On the other hand, the flange must be pressed onto the motor shaft using heat. Fixation is carried out by bolting or welding.

Helpful advice! The thread should go in the opposite direction relative to the direction in which the engine rotates. Otherwise, the nut securing the circle will unwind.

The working winding of the motor is connected to the cable. It has a resistance of 12 ohms, which can be calculated using a multimeter. The starting winding for a DIY knife sharpener will have 30 ohms. Then the bed is made. It is recommended to take a metal corner for it.

Technology for creating a wood cutting machine

Manufacturing technology of a homemade cutting machine:

  1. Cutting parts from the corner for assembling the frame (total size - 120x40x60 cm).
  2. Frame assembly by welding.
  3. Fixing the channel (guide) by welding.
  4. Installation of vertical posts (2 pcs.) on the channel (bolt connection).
  5. Assembling a frame from pipes for installing an electric motor and shaft at the required angle (45x60 cm).
  6. Installing a plate with a motor at the rear of the frame.
  7. Manufacturing of a shaft equipped with flanges, supports and a pulley (flange protrusion height - 3.2 cm).
  8. Installation of supports, bearings and pulleys on the shaft. The bearings are fixed to the upper frame in recesses made in the plate.
  9. Installation of the box with the electrical circuit on the lower section of the frame.
  10. Installing the shaft in the area between the posts. Diameter – 1.2 cm. A bushing should be placed on top of the shaft with the minimum possible gap so that these elements slide.
  11. Welding a rocker arm made from a channel (80 cm) onto a bushing. The size of the rocker arms must be within the following ratio: 1:3. WITH outside the springs must be secured.

Helpful advice! Experts advise using asynchronous motor. This motor is not particularly demanding. For networks with 3 phases, a motor with a power of 1.5-3 kW is required; for single-phase networks this figure must be increased by a third. A connection via a capacitor will be required.

All that remains is to mount the motor on the short arm of the rocker arm. The cutting element is placed on the long arm. The shaft and motor are connected using a belt drive. For the tabletop you can use a sheet of metal or a planed board.

Assembling a metal milling machine with your own hands

Step-by-step instructions for making a homemade metal milling machine:

  1. The column and frame are made of metal channel. The result should be a U-shaped structure, where the base of the tool acts as the lower cross member.
  2. Guides are made from the corner. The material must be sanded and connected to the column with bolts.
  3. Guides for the console are made from a profile pipe with a square cross-section. Here you need to insert pins with screwed threads. The console will be moved using a diamond-shaped car jack to a height of 10 cm. In this case, the amplitude to the side is 13 cm, and the tabletop can move within 9 cm.
  4. The working surface is cut out of a plywood sheet and fastened with a screw. The fastener heads need to be recessed.
  5. A vice made of a pipe with a square cross-section and a metal angle welded together is installed on the working surface. It is better to use a threaded pin as a fixing element for the workpiece.

Note! It is better to secure the rotating element in the frame so that the spindle is directed downward. To fix it, you need to weld the jumpers in advance; you will need screws and nuts.

After this, you need to attach a cone (Morse 2) to the spindle and install a collet or drill chuck on it.

Rules for operating a wood jointing machine with your own hands

In the designs of a hand-made jointing machine, it is very important to correctly set the equipment settings so that errors do not exceed the permitted values:

  • perpendicular – maximum 0.1 mm/cm;
  • plane – 0.15mm/m.

You can familiarize yourself with the technology of making a jointer with your own hands using a video.

If during operation a mossy or scorched effect appears on the treated surface, it means the cutting elements have become dull. To make processing parts with dimensions less than 3x40 cm more comfortable, they need to be held using pushers.

A curved surface of the workpiece after processing has been performed indicates that the correct placement of the knives and the working surface has been disrupted. These elements need to be set again.

Homemade garage tool

Often, skilled craftsmen arrange a balcony and a home pantry, due to small area, only allow you to store necessary tools, and that’s not all. To work in a garage, you should always have an extension cord on hand and store it there. This device you can do it yourself. To do this, you will need two plywood disks, which should be connected with bolts. Place tubes on the bolts between the circles and secure. The wire will be wound around them. The bolt heads must be recessed so that the extension handle does not touch them when rotating. On the other side of the coil, cut a hole the size of a cup for the socket, which you then place in it. Secure the box to the disk with small screws. You can use a wooden door handle as a handle.

Homemade garden tool

Most gardeners decorate their plots with annual flowers. It is beautiful and attractive, but there are difficulties during planting. Small seeds planted in a row become very thick because they are not sown in portions. You have to thin them out repeatedly, which is traumatic root system. In this case, a manually controlled mechanical seeder will help. The device has a seed box, a dispenser, wheels and a handle. Seeds from the body through the cutout fall into small holes located on the dispenser rod. When moving, the shaft rotates and the seeds fall into the ground one by one. The order is due to the fact that the grooves on the shaft are drilled evenly at a certain distance from each other. By varying the diameter and pitch of the holes, you can sow seeds various sizes. The brush, located on the front wall of the housing, regulates the number of seeds falling into the ground. Steel wheels are attached to both sides of the rotating cylinder. Several cuts are made around the circumference of the disk, which will allow the steel to be bent, creating petals. This will help improve the device's traction with the soil.

Foam cutting device

When building or renovating a house, a large amount of equipment is needed, which is simply impossible to buy due to the volume of work, as well as lack of funds. You have to use homemade machines and tools. When insulating the wall of a building, you will need a device that helps cut the foam into even pieces. It is not profitable to buy cut material in sheets because of the many scraps that will have to be thrown away. Therefore, having purchased polystyrene foam in cubes and made a machine, you can cut the insulation yourself. To do this, you will need a small 250 W transformer. You also need one taken from an electric stove and stretched into a thread. A spring to tension the spiral, two studs and a table top. The transformer will glow with which you can easily cut the foam. It should be noted that the cutting process cannot be stopped, since the hot spiral will melt the insulation in an unnecessary place. It is necessary to work with this machine in a room with good ventilation.

Carpentry workbench

A carpenter's workbench is a durable table with a working surface on which to fix holdfast(2 pieces), clamps to secure the workpiece when planing with a plane, there are places for installation milling cutter and other manual machines.

Important. The dimensions of the workbench are selected based on practical considerations.

The height should ensure ease of work, taking into account the actual height of the master. The length should be at least 1 m (usually 1.7-2 m), and width - 70-80 cm.

Instructions for making a carpentry workbench:

  1. The working surface is made in the form of a shield with tightly fitted boards with a thickness of at least 55 mm. Beech, oak, and hornbeam are best suited. They should first be soaked in drying oil. Strengthening is achieved with a beam measuring 4-5 cm, which is attached along the entire perimeter of the shield.
  2. Vertical table supports can be made of pine or linden. Typically, a beam measuring 12x12 or 15x15 cm with a length of about 120-135 cm is used. The supporting elements are connected by horizontal jumpers made of a wide board, fixed at a height of 20-30 cm from the floor.
  3. Tools and accessories are stored on shelves that are located under the lid. It is better to make them in the form of a cabinet with a door. Shelf panels can be placed on the wall above the workbench.
  4. A pair of homemade or factory-made carpentry vices is attached to the working surface.

Reference. The workbench can be mobile (movable), folding (collapsible) or stationary. In the latter case, it is recommended to bury the supports into the ground by 15-20 cm.

Vise

For a homemade vice you will need a long screw rod with a diameter of at least 20 mm with a threaded part length of at least 14-16 cm, metal studs and wooden blocks.

Manufacturing is carried out in the following order:

  1. A wooden block is cut out (possibly from pine) about 20x30 cm in size and at least 5 cm thick, in which a hole for a screw is drilled in the center, and at the bottom there are 2 holes for guide pins. This first vise jaw is permanently fixed to the work surface.
  2. The second sponge is cut from a similar board and has dimensions of 20x18 cm. This will be a movable element.
  3. A screw pin is passed through the jaws. To prevent displacement of elements, studs with a diameter of about 8-10 mm are fixed. A handle is installed on the screw rod.

Features of creating a wood lathe

A homemade lathe for working with wooden blanks includes the following elements:

  1. bed. It must have sufficient strength. It is better to make it from metal profile(pipe, corner), but it can also be made from wooden beams. It is important to securely fasten the frame to the workshop floor and weight the structure at the bottom.
  2. Headstock or clamping spindle. As this element of the machine, you can use a head from a high-power drill.
  3. Tailstock. In order to ensure longitudinal feed of the workpiece, it is better to use a standard factory spindle with 3-4 cams.
  4. Support or stop for cutters. It must provide reliable fastening and the ability to move towards the workpiece, which is ensured by a screw rod.
  5. Tool table. A working surface should be formed on the bed on which cutters and other tools can be laid out.
  6. Drive unit. To create torque, an electric motor with a rotation speed of 1500 rpm and a power of 250-400 W is used. You can use a motor from a washing machine. A belt drive is used as a transmission, for which pulleys of the required size are installed on the shafts.

Thicknesser

A homemade thicknessing machine for wood includes the following elements:

  1. bed. It is made of 2 frames welded from a corner 40x40 or 50x50 mm. The frames are connected with studs.
  2. Broach. Rubber squeezing rollers from a washing machine work well. They are mounted on bearings and rotated manually using a handle.
  3. Working surface, table top. Used wide board, impregnated with drying oil, which is secured to the frame with bolts.
  4. Drive unit. You need a three-phase electric motor with a power of 5-6 kW with a rotation speed of at least 3000 rpm.
  5. casing. To protect the rotating parts, a casing of 4-5 mm thick steel sheet is installed, mounted on a frame made of steel angle 20x20 mm.

Ball joint remover

It can be made in different ways:

  1. Lever type. These are 2 levers connected in the center. On one side, a coupling bolt is installed on them. When acting on the support, it unscrews, bringing the ends of the levers closer together. In this case, one end is inserted between the support and the eye, the second - under the finger.
  2. Option "wedge". From metal plate the workpiece is cut out in the form of a wedge. From the side of the upper corner, a strictly vertical cut is made at 70% of the height. This wedge is installed between the ball joint and the eye. Then it is hammered in until the finger comes out of the socket.

Cutting machine

A homemade option for the workshop is offered - a cutting machine suitable for cutting angles, pipes, square profiles, and fittings. The design of the device is simple:

  • Desktop;
  • spring return brackets;
  • platform for attaching an angle grinder;
  • emphasis

For this purpose, special protection is made, similar to the standard casing that comes with the tool. It has a slide, two handles and a rotating device. The slide looks like a plate measuring 200 x 120 millimeters, with a slot for the saw blade to exit.

The plate is attached on one side to the casing on a hinge, the other to a steel strip with a 9 mm wide slot for sliding along an M8x1.5 pin, which is on the casing for fixing with a wing nut.

Two handles are welded to the casing to hold the sawing machine during operation. It is very convenient to cut and saw thin lumber, and the high speed of the machine carpentry machine allow you to easily cut material up to 30 millimeters thick.

Vertical drilling model

The frame can be made from pieces of angle 50x50 millimeters and a steel sheet 5 millimeters thick. To do this, weld two corners along the edges of the sheet along the entire length; they will serve as legs. Table size 350 x 200 millimeters. Weld a bracket on top with square pipe 80 mm high for mounting a stand.

The stand or guide for the drill is made of a square pipe three millimeters thick. A section is welded into the upper hole water pipe eight millimeters long. A cable tensioning mechanism is inserted into it. The height of the stand is 700 millimeters. The stand is inserted into the bracket and crimped with four bolts - two on two sides of the square pipe.

The carriage is a movable unit on which the drill is attached. It is made of 50x50 corners welded together, the height is 170 millimeters, the eyes are made of strip three millimeters thick. An axle is inserted into the eyes, around which the cable is wound.

A continuation of the axis is the handle that drives the carriage.

The carriage drive consists of an axis on which a cable and a handle are wound. One end of the cable is fixed to the bottom bracket. The upper end of the cable is fixed in the pipe at the upper end of the rack. Attached to the carriage special bracket With seat for an electric drill. The drill itself is tightened with a special clamp made from a strip 2 mm thick and 40 mm wide.
